Choosing valid metrics means identifying indicators that accurately reflect user engagement, conversion, or satisfaction—regardless of data source. Step 1 involves reviewing goals, defining audiences, and selecting KPIs that align with real-world outcomes. For example, instead of tracking arbitrary clicks, businesses focus on time-on-page, session duration, or drop-off points—measures that reveal meaningful behavior patterns.
Valid metrics are verified, repeatable, and consistent across platforms. They stand up to scrutiny in multi-channel campaigns and analytics systems, providing a reliable basis for optimization and forecasting.
Common Questions About Valid Metric Selections
What makes a metric “valid”?
A valid metric aligns with business objectives and accurately captures user behavior without bias, noise, or misrepresentation.
What’s the difference between good and bad metrics?
Good metrics drive action—like conversion rates or customer retention—while bad metrics often appear impressive but lack connection to real outcomes.
